Ordinals
beta
Address 3DoMmwzb6EpoiP9aJH65XcpNKyjPqes6nU
sat balance
5908078
runes balances
outputs
b18721465ba0163df47916ce20684d82f0cd7a2471ccb85c187322c8957ebbf5:0